Iran: the conservatives' boulevard in the next elections to maintain their hold. Some 61 million Iranians are called to the polls next Friday to elect the 290 deputies of the Iranian Parliament and the members of the Assembly of Experts.

The reformist and moderate camp, whose candidates were largely rejected, is divided between those who decided to boycott the vote and those who decide to participate. Most figures in the reform andmoderate camp were rejected in advance by the Council of Guardians of the Constitution, a body controlled by conservative clerics.
